加味黄芪赤风汤含药血清对LPS诱导的小鼠肾小球系膜细胞ColⅣ、MMP-2及TIMP-2表达的影响  被引量:12

Effect of Modified Hangqi Chifeng Decoction Containing Serum on the Expression of Col Ⅳ, MMP-2, and TIMP-2 in Glomerular Mesangial Cells Induced by LPS

摘  要:目的探讨加味黄芪赤风汤对脂多糖(LPS)诱导的小鼠肾小球系膜细胞(glomerular mesangial cells,GMCs)细胞外基质(extracellular matrix,ECM)Ⅳ型胶原蛋白(collagenⅣ,ColⅣ)、基质金属蛋白酶2(matrix metalloproteinase-2,MMP-2)及基质金属蛋白酶抑制酶2(tissue inhibitor of metalloproteinase-2,TIMP-2)水平的影响。方法采用血清药理学方法制备正常血清及替米沙坦、加味黄芪赤风汤高、中、低剂量含药血清。体外培养GMCs,以LPS作为刺激因子,诱导系膜细胞增殖。将GMCs分为正常组、模型组、替米沙坦组及加味黄芪赤风汤高、中、低剂量组(简称中药高、中、低剂量组)。采用ELISA法检测各组GMCs上清液中ColⅣ含量,Western blot法检测GMCs中MMP-2及TIMP-2蛋白表达水平。结果与正常组比较,LPS刺激72 h后,模型组GMCs上清ColⅣ含量明显增多,系膜细胞MMP-2及TIMP-2蛋白表达均明显上调,MMP-2/TIMP-2比例下调(均P<0.01);与模型组比较,中药高、中剂量组及替米沙坦组ColⅣ含量明显减少(P<0.01);中药中、低剂量组MMP-2蛋白表达明显下调(P<0.01,P<0.05);替米沙坦组及中药高、中、低剂量组TIMP-2蛋白表达均下调(P<0.01)。中药高剂量组TIMP-2蛋白表达水平明显低于中药低剂量组(P<0.01);替米沙坦组、中药高、中剂量组MMP-2/TIMP-2比例明显上调(P<0.01)。结论加味黄芪赤风汤可调节LPS诱导的GMSc ECM中MMP-2/TIMP-2比例失调,抑制ECM中ColⅣ的过度产生,促进ECM降解,减少ECM积聚,从而延缓肾小球硬化的进程。Objective To explore the effect of Modified Hangqi Chifeng Decoction(MHCD) on levels of collagen type Ⅳ(ColⅣ), matrix metalloproteinase-2(MMP-2), tissue inhibitor of metalloproteinase-2(TIMP-2) in extracellular matrix(ECM) of glomerular mesangial cells(GMCs) in LPS induced mice. Methods Normal serum and telmisartan, high, medium, low dose MHCD containing serums were prepared by using serum pharmacology meth-od. GMCs were cultured in vitro. The proliferation of mesangial cells were induced using LPS as stimulating factor.GMCs were divided into six groups, i.e., the normal group, the model group, the telmisartan group, high, medium and low dose MHCD groups. ColⅣ content in the supernatant of mesangial cells was detected using ELISA. Protein expressions of MMP-2 and TIMP-2 were detected using Western blot. Results Compared with the normalgroup, ColⅣ content obviously increased in the model group after 72-h LPS stimulation;protein expressions of MMP-2 and TIMP-2 were obviously up-regulated, and MMP-2/TIMP-2 ratio was down-regulated in the model group(P〈0. 01). Compared with the model group, ColⅣ content obviously decreased in high and medium dose MHCD groups and the telmisartan group(P〈0. 01);protein expressions of MMP-2 were obviously down-regulated in medium and low dose MHCD groups(P〈0. 01, P〈0. 05);the protein expression of TIMP-2 was obviously down-regulated in high, medium, low dose MHCD groups and the telmisartan group(P〈0. 01). The protein expression of TIMP-2 was obviously lower in the high dose MHCD group than in the low dose MHCD group(P〈0. 01). MMP-2/TIMP-2 ratio was obviously up-regulated in the telmisartan group, high and medium dose MHCD groups(P〈0. 01). Conclusion MHCD could regulate disordered MMP-2/TIMP-2 ratio in LPS induced ECM, inhibit excessive production of ColⅣ in ECM, promote the degradation of ECM, reduce the accumulation of ECM, thereby, delaying the process of glomerular sclerosis.
